3 days on, MGNREGA employees continue to protest against Govt

5 Dariya News

Srinagar 25-Mar-2017

On the third consecutive day, the association of Mahatma Gandhi National Rural Employment Guarantee Act (MGNREGA) employees on Saturday continued to protest against the government for ‘failing to regularize them from past several years’.The members of MGNREGA holding banners assembled at Srinagar’s Pratap Park and staged sit-in there.Notably, on Thursday, scores of MGNREGA association members were detained by the police while they tried to march towards commercial hub Lal Chowk while on Friday, the employees had closed their mouths with tape observed sit-in at Srinagar’s Pratap Park.Meanwhile, the association today continued to hold a silent protest to press the government their demands.

The protesters told KNS from past several years, the government is making tall promises with them regarding the regularization of their duties but unfortunately not even a single promise has been fulfilled with the employees.“We are on streets today to protest against the failures of the government in regularizing our duties. We have been urging the successive regimes to regularize our duties but unfortunately our plea went in deaf ears. We went from pillar to post to seek justice but unfortunately all in vein,” the employees added.The protesters said that until the government won’t fulfill their demands, they will continue to protest against them.However, the protesters later dispersed peacefully.
